Flood risk in Appledore

High flood risk in part of this area

2 of 9 sampled points in Zone 3

Not in a flood zoneZone 2Zone 3

Zone 3 is land with a 1 in 100 (1%) or greater chance of flooding in any year.

Recorded as Fluvial Models · Fluvial Models and Fluvial Events

Environment Agency flood map for planning · 9-point area sample, not a check on any one property
